    Traditional Mallorcan Cuisine

    Mallorcan cuisine is a fusion of Mediterranean flavors, with influences from the island’s Moorish and Spanish past. Some of the best places to try traditional Mallorcan cuisine include:

    • Ca’n Costa: This family-run restaurant has been serving traditional Mallorcan dishes for over 30 years. Try their famous sofrit pagès, a hearty vegetable stew.
    • El Olivo: This cozy restaurant in the heart of Soller offers a range of traditional Mallorcan dishes, including pa amb oli (bread with olive oil) and ensaimada (a sweet pastry).
    • La Tasca de Soller: This rustic tavern serves up delicious tapas and traditional Mallorcan dishes, including botifarra amb mongetes (white beans and sausage).

    Street Food and Markets

    Soller’s street food and markets are a great place to try local specialties and snacks. Here are some of the best:

    Street Food

    Soller’s street food scene is a great place to try local specialties. Here are some of the best:

    • Churros con Chocolate: These sweet fried dough pastries are typically served with a rich chocolate dipping sauce.
    • Pan con Tomate: This simple but delicious snack consists of bread rubbed with garlic and tomato and drizzled with olive oil.
    • Empanadas: These savory pastries are typically filled with meat, seafood, or vegetables and are a great snack on the go.
